Softball Recap: Crestview Bulldogs vs. Navarre Raiders
Crestview suffered their biggest loss since March 6th on Monday. They came up short against the Navarre Raiders, falling 15-5.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Raiders this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 8-0 back in March.
Ava Secor was cooking despite her team's loss, scoring two runs and stealing two bases while getting on base in all four of her plate appearances. Presley Houser also deserves some recognition as she snagged her first stolen base of the season.
Crestview has traveled a rocky road recently, having lost seven of their last eight matchups. That's put a noticeable dent in their 5-11 record this season. As for Navarre, they moved to 7-6 with that win, which also ended their five-game losing streak.
Crestview wasted no time getting back out on the field and has already played their next contest, a 4-2 defeat against Milton on the 10th. As for Navarre,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next game, an 11-0 victory against Choctawhatchee on the 8th.
